What a pricing page leaves out
Shared or dedicated changes everything
An address you share carries the reputation of everyone else on it. That is acceptable for some work and fatal for anything involving a login. The price difference between shared and dedicated usually reflects exactly this.
Who pays for the requests that fail
On a hard target, failures are the majority of your traffic. Whether those failures are billed decides the real cost, and the clause covering it is rarely on the pricing page.
The limit that stops the job
Rate limits are often enforced per account rather than per plan, which means buying more traffic does not raise them. Confirm how yours scales before you assume a bigger plan runs faster.

The test that beats this page
It is a small amount of money for an answer that is actually about your target.
- Put a few dollars on each account. Trials are fine for a first look, but paid traffic is what you will actually be buying.
- Run them against the site you actually care about, using the code you actually run, within the same hour.
- Track the success rate and the bandwidth. A cheap gigabyte that fails half the time is not cheap.
- Run a sample of the addresses through an independent lookup, because advertised geography and actual geography differ more often than the market admits.
- Keep the winner, and repeat the whole thing quarterly, because pools age.
